Important Factors to Keep in Mind While Selecting a Postgraduate Course
1. Accreditation and Recognition
It is essential that students verify whether the institution is approved by governing authorities like the University Grants Commission (UGC) or the All India Council for Technical Education (AICTE) before joining any postgraduate program. Accreditation guarantees that the institution is of acceptable academic standards and that the degree is acceptable in the labor market. Accredited institutions are also more credible when seeking employment or pursuing higher education.
2. Course Curriculum and Industry Relevance
There should be a well-planned curriculum to ensure that students get the most current knowledge and skills demanded in the field. Industry-relevant courses, research experiences, and practice exposure through live projects or internships should be included in postgraduate courses. Students must analyze the syllabus, faculty strength, and learning methodologies to determine whether they align with current trends in the industry and technology developments.
3. Placement and Career Support
One of the key areas in post-graduation is career progression. Schools that provide excellent placement assistance, career guidance, and collaborations with top companies can greatly enhance placement opportunities for students. It is recommended to see previous placement histories, the quality of recruiters, and the existence of career progression programs like resume preparation, interview skills, and networking sessions.
4. Research and Innovation Facilities
For research-oriented students, it is important to select a university with good research centers, labs, and funding. Research-oriented postgraduate courses, especially in science, engineering, and medicine, demand exposure to good resources, journals, and mentoring from competent professors. Universities with a high emphasis on innovation and research partnerships offer greater opportunities for academic development and international exposure.
5. Infrastructure and Learning Environment
Campus infrastructure quality plays an important part in determining the quality of the overall learning process. A university well-developed will possess well-equipped classrooms, libraries, labs, and support technology systems. Besides, elements like hostel, connectivity, safety, and activities for students make for a balanced learning environment supporting academic as well as personal development.
6. Financial Considerations and ROI
Postgraduate study involves a huge financial outlay, such as tuition, accommodation, and study materials. Students must weigh the cost of study against the return on investment (ROI). Programs that equip them with highly remunerative employment, quality placement assistance, and career progression opportunities warrant the financial outlay. Researching funding alternatives such as education loans and part-time employment opportunities can also make the financial burden more manageable.
